How does the heater know when the pump is running? Does the heater have a flow switch that only allows the heater to turn when the water is running through it? Sorry if this is a dumb question.
@electricianron_New_Jersey
2 жыл бұрын
Not a dumb question. I imagine through a set of contacts in the filter. Definitely wiring within the appliance.
@SqueakyHinge
Жыл бұрын
The heater has a pressure switch on the inlet of the piping system which will close the control circuit if that pressure sensor senses pressure - from the pump running - so the heater will run.

Hi Ron, on outdoor outlets for a deck does NJ code require gfci outlets and gfci breakers or is a gfci breaker with wr outlets ok.
@electricianron_New_Jersey
2 жыл бұрын
A circuit breaker or outlet is acceptable because it's only required to be GFCI-protected. I will tell you the outlet will be cheaper than the circuit breaker. The outlet MUST BE 'WR' which means weather-resistant.
